About James Allen

James Allen is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, General Health Professions, Health, Earth-Surface Processes and Ecology, having authored 282 papers that have together received 7.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Community Health and Development (32 papers), Indigenous Health, Education, and Rights (28 papers), Transactional Analysis in Psychotherapy (22 papers), Psychotherapy Techniques and Applications (20 papers), Coastal and Marine Dynamics (18 papers), Personality Disorders and Psychopathology (15 papers), Suicide and Self-Harm Studies (12 papers) and Health Policy Implementation Science (12 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Health (776 citations), Earth-Surface Processes (619 citations), Clinical Psychology (1.2k citations), General Health Professions (1.1k citations) and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(485 citations). James Allen has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Norway. Frequent co-authors include Stacy Rasmus, David B. Henry, Gerald V. Mohatt, Carlotta Ching Ting Fok, Diane Litman, Barbara Ann Allen, Kelly L. Hazel, Bernd Irmer, Prashant Bordia and Nerina L. Jimmieson. Their work appears in journals such as Prevention Science, American Journal of Community Psychology, Journal of Coastal Research, International Journal of Circumpolar Health and Transcultural Psychiatry.
